Schuerman GS, Van Meervelt L, Loakes D, Brown DM, Kong Thoo Li, Moore MH, Salisbury SAA thymine-like base analogue forms wobble pairs with adenine in a Z-DNA duplexJ. Mol. Biol. v282, p.1005-1011The DNA hexamer d(CACGPG), in which dP is the ambivalent pyrimidine nucleoside analogue 2"-deoxy-beta-d-ribofuranosyl-(6H,8H-3, 4-dihydropyrimido[4,5-c][1,2]oxazin-7-one), crystallises as a left-handed Z-DNA duplex. X-ray analysis at 1.5 A shows that both P. A base-pairs are of the wobble type. This result appears inconsistent with other evidence from hybridisation and NMR studies of P-containing oligonucleotides, which suggests that, while P can form stable base-pairs with either A or G, thymine-like properties are more pronounced....
